To connect the Pyle PSWNV480 Power Supply, ensure the power supply is turned off, then attach the output connectors to the corresponding input terminals on your device. Ensure all connections are secure before turning on the power supply.
The maximum output current of the Pyle PSWNV480 Power Supply is 40A. Always ensure your device's current requirements do not exceed this limit.

If the power supply overheats, turn it off immediately. Check for adequate ventilation and ensure the fan is functioning. Allow the unit to cool down before restarting.

The power supply includes over-voltage, over-current, and short-circuit protection to ensure safe operation. It is also equipped with a cooling fan to prevent overheating.
To replace the fuse, first disconnect the power supply from the outlet. Locate the fuse holder on the back panel, unscrew it, and replace the blown fuse with a new one of the same rating.
